Sam Maloof: Woodworking Profile by Sam Maloof.

A close-up look at Maloof"s craft, design, and technique. Sam Maloof is one of the fathers of contemporary woodworking. Now in this video profile of a master craftsman, you can see Maloof at work and at home, and see how his furniture embodies his ideas on craft, design and technique.

This visually rich documentary spans a week with Maloof while he builds and discusses various designs, including his oft-imitated rocker. It"s a chance to savor the nuances and substance that make Sam Maloof an inspiration to woodworkers everywhere.

You"ll discover how a comfortable chair seat can be shaped like a staved container; how the router and rasp can sculpt joints both visually and structurally strong; how rockers can be laminated, shaped and positioned for well-balanced chair; and how decorative splines can strengthen a pedestal table.
